As has become usual every couple of weeks or so, I released a new version of OCRFeeder!

This is version 0.6.1 and the main changes this time are:

  • Now you can increase or decrease the zoom using Ctrl+Mouse wheel. This kind of shortcut is well known in many GNOME applications and even I was missing it;
  • Warning dialogs are now shown when something went wrong while opening an image;
  • Fixed encoding problem when reading non-ASCII characters;
  • Fixed error when configuring a new engine;
  • Improved Debian package’s files (thanks to Alberto Garcia)
  • Fixed zoom issues (sometimes the allowed zoom would not be consistent among tries);
